Guys,

Whats the best way or product to manage your drop shot weight when not in use? Sometimes I run leaders that extend past the bottom of my grip which makes it tough to manage from flopping around while driving. Iv'e used the velcro and hair bungees and they work well with a shorter leader. I also try and stay away from anyting to bulky.

Any tips guys thanks.

I use Luna Sea rod floats on all my rods. They are comfortable and serve well in balancing my setups. For dropshots, I slide the weight in between the float and cork handle. Works great. Sometimes I use a lure wrap in addition to this to reduce snagging of tie hook with other rods in transport.
